Bangladesh: Korea resumes taking Bangladeshi expatriate workers

DHAKA, 06 January 2022, (TON): Some 92 Bangladeshi workers left Dhaka for South Korea by chartered flights operated by a Korean air company.

A South Korean Embassy press release said “it was the first batch of Bangladesh expatriate workers going to Korea this year.”

The South Korean Government suspended the recruitment of foreign workers in March 2020.

It resumed receiving expatriates last month.

 After the resumption, so far, a total of 203 Bangladesh expatriate workers have traveled to Korea. In December, 111 Bangladesh workers were allowed into Korea.

Among 92 workers who were admitted this time, 44 workers were newly employed while the rest of them were re-entry workers.

Korea has been admitting medium and low-skilled foreign workers from 16 countries including Bangladesh through the EPS (Employment Permit System) program.
